It's very normal. Your body is just getting used to all the hormonal changes it's going through. Stress and exercise can effect your period, too. If you keep skipping, or your periods become irregular, see your gyno. Otherwise don't worry.

It is normal when you first get your period and all through your teen years for your period to be irregular, but if you skip more than 3 months, I would check with a doctor. It is good that you are not sexually active, so you can rule out STDs and pregnancy.
